We skipped it because so many people warned us. Tok cutoff rattled our rig pretty good this year though.
One thing to watch out for. We filled our tank with fresh water at Watsons Lake in the downtown RV park where we stayed. Next day we noticed the water from our fresh water tank was brown and disgusting. We had to flush and sanitize our tanks.
And one tip, there's a beautiful (and free) USFW campground on a lake not far over the border once you get into Alaska. Deadman lake campground.
I've been buying DEF at Walmarts but seems like I get the last one every time I buy it.

Just drove from Fairbanks to Seattle in the last 4 days. Take DEF with you. Every small town we stopped at did not have any. Didn't see any at the Walmart in Whitehorse either, but the auto stores there may have some.
